Output f640df33613c94d875a968c48e4e74f73dbedda27f7f2e978aaf3e041157d8b2:0

value
18210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b5fc8e24526db6e520436b67c70a0ddac869de1 OP_EQUAL
address
3FrZQWqf1e21tEgn3M5b72QtDSAoTycBgd
transaction
f640df33613c94d875a968c48e4e74f73dbedda27f7f2e978aaf3e041157d8b2
confirmations
446074
spent
true